When using the nova-cloud-controller charm in HA with the config option single-nova-consoleauth set to true, its expected for the nova-consoleauth service to be run in just a single unit at the time. The service management (start/stop) is performed by pacemaker in accordance with the cluster health using the OCF resource agent[0]. Its required for the service to be disabled by default on upstart (trusty) or systemd (>=xenial). This change disables the service by using the service_pause charmhelpers call which considers both cases (upstart/systemd) when the ha relation is present and the single-nova-consoleauth option is used. Also, this change fixes LP: #1660244 (Services not running that should be: nova-consoleauth) by removing it from the resource_map when ha + single-nova-consoleauth is used.
